At its Main, betting is predicated on chance and odds. Any time you spot a wager, you happen to be predicting the end result of the occasion. Bookmakers or betting platforms established odds that replicate the likelihood of each achievable consequence. These odds determine how much you stand to get Should your prediction is proper. Odds can seem in numerous formats—fractional, decimal, or moneyline—and knowledge how you can examine them is essential. By way of example, fractional odds clearly show your potential profit relative to your stake, even though decimal odds display the overall return, such as your first guess. Moneyline odds, normally used in the U.S., clearly show exactly how much you could win from the $100 bet or simply how much you have to wager to gain that amount.

Irrespective of its leisure price, betting carries major hazard. Many of us drop more than they gain, plus the thrill of gambling can at times bring on harmful habits, especially when people chase losses or bet dollars they can't afford to shed. This is where accountable gambling comes into play. Liable gambling suggests placing crystal clear limits on time and cash, figuring out when to stroll absent, and treating betting as being a sort of leisure, not a method to make cash flow. Furthermore, it consists of recognizing the indications of dilemma gambling, such as betting in solution, lying about losses, or sensation panic or guilt associated with gambling exercise.
